Rundgren: The New Cars improves on original model
Todd Rundgren thinks that the re-tooled Cars may actually be better than the old model. He's joined by former Cars keyboardist Greg Hawkes, guitarist Elliot Easton, Kasim Sultan on bass and drummer Prairie Prince to form The New Cars.

Milwaukee drivers among the safest, study says
Research conducted by Allstate Insurance Co. found that Milwaukee was the safest city in the United States among those with populations between 500,000 and 1 million.
